WebApr 17, 2024 · (LA) 'Susannah Fulllerton' 2006, Pryor 'Susannah Fullerton' ( Heather Pryor, R. 2003). Seedling 73/96-B. LA, 41" (105 cm), Midseason late bloom. Dark ruby red (RHS 59A), lemon rim and reverse, lemon and white spray pattern around strong lime steeple signal on all petals; style arms lemon, tipped ruby red; ruffled, slightly reflexed. WebSusannah Fullerton has been President of the Jane Austen Society of Australia since 1996. She is a worldwide authority on Austen's life and fiction, and her books have been praised by Claire Tomalin, Maggie Lane, Deirdre le Faye and Hazel Jones. WebDec 14, 2012 · About Susannah Fullerton, OAM, FRSN, President of the Jane Austen Society of Australia: Susannah Fullerton is a Canadian-born Australian author and literary historian. She has been president of the Jane Austen Society of Australia since 1996, which is the largest literary society in Australia.
